Preparative Separation of Aloin Diastereoisomers by High-Speed Countercurrent Chromatography Combined with Silica Gel Column Chromatography
|
Abstract:
Aloin,naturally a mixture of two diastereoisomers,aloin A and aloin B,is the major(anthraquinone) in aloe,and now served as one of the important control constituents in most of the commercial aloe products.High-speed countercurrent chromatography(HSCCC) combined with(silica) gel column chromatography was developed for the preparative separation of the two individual(aloins).Aloin A(98%) and aloin B(96%) were obtained.Fast atom bombardment mass spectrometry(FAB-MS),()~1H nuclear magnetic resonance(()~1H NMR) and GOESY(gradient-enhanced nuclear Overhauser effect spectroscopy) were employed for the elucidation of their structure conformation.The developed method is of high preparative capacity and high efficiency in resolution.
